The 5% amount is also the figure a TSP participant must contribute in order to take full advantage of the agency matching contributions. The first 3% of pay that TSP participants contribute is matched dollar-for-dollar. The next 2% is matched at 50 cents on the dollar ... chopt birmingham al menuWebJan 1, 2013 · For new Federal employees covered under this requirement, the contribution rate is generally 4.4 percent (rather than the earlier 0.8 percent or 3.3 percent).
